Weight gain can affect our
skin and the structures which
support it. The heavy tissues
can stretch skin and increase
its length and can result
in damage to elastic fibers.
This excessive skin can then
rub against adjacent skin
and result in rashes and abrasions.
Skin that is stretched out
can also hang down, and when
we bend over, this distant
weight puts a strain on our
back.

The aging process and weight
gain and especially rapid
weight gain and loss can have
a significant effect on breast
shape, size and position.
When women have reached a
stable weight, it is a good
time to reassess breast shape
and position. It’s also a
good to start thinking about
what size a patient would
like and what size might “go”
with their physique to complement
their shape. Should loosening
of the breast occur after
weight loss, a breast lift
can provide a good alternative
to improve breast shape as
well as raise the position
of the breast on the chest
to create a fuller and more
youthful appearance. Breast
lifts can be combined with
a breast implant surgery to
achieve more fullness of the
upper portion of the breast.
